Humans may colonise alien planet in next 100 years

Indian Express, Agencies, London, The US military is planning a mission of flying mankind in the next 100 years to an alien planet – which would otherwise take around 70,000 years to reach with current technologies. The project, called the 100-Year Starship study, will see key decisions taken within the next 12 weeks - such as where to head for, reports the Sun. Our own solar system''s inhospitable planets have been ruled out. Alpha Centauri - among the stars
closest to us - is a candidate. America''s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ency is offering a 300,000 pounds prize to scientists who can begin overcoming hurdles such as whether to freeze humans for the mission - or to send embryos that can be “born” when near their new home. In September a meeting will take place in Florida, U.S, and initial plans will be drawn up for the exploration and colonisation of world beyond the solar system. Source: Indian Express
